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To ensure inexpensive and high quality greening by spraying crushed pieces of bark of cedar and Japanese cypress, paper making foreign matter and the like to the seed of a vegetation plant, a fertilizer and the grass or the crushed chips of timber produced by cutting down at a jobsite on a slope by mixing high temperature heated particulate coal. SOLUTION: Because the crushed pieces 1e of the bark of mixing cedar and Japanese cypress have feather-like fiber structure, constant coupling force is displayed by intertangling. Then, because they have a cellular structure divided into a number of fine chambers containing air and moisture, a fixed gas phase and a liquid phase are constituted. Thus, bacteria are helped propagating, and the compost of the crushed chips 1a of grass and timber is promoted. Furthermore, the crushed pieces 1e of the bark, paper making foreign matter and the like are sprayed with a compressor by additionally mixing high temperature heated particulate coal. The outflow of soil dressing 1a is prevented during rainfall on a spraying slope to secure proper water holding and fertilizer holding, and the compost of the crushed chips 1d of grass and timber is promoted. Thereby the early greening of the slope is promoted to secure long maintenance.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the Invention The present invention relates to a slope vegetation work at a cut-off point of a mountain road or a bank of a river.

Description of the Related Art Conventionally, slopes have been hardened with concrete for work to prevent collapse of road cut-off points and revetment work for river embankments, but in recent years, from the viewpoint of aesthetics and protection of the environment and nature, slopes with flowering and tree vegetation have been used. The greening method has been adopted everywhere.

[0003] The spraying method is generally used for these works, which includes seeds of vegetation such as flowers, fertilizer,
It was a method in which crushed chips of trees and grasses generated by logging at the site were mixed into the soil, and sprayed with a compressor on the entire slope with a constant thickness.

[0004] However, in these conventional slope spraying methods, the seeds of the vegetation plants sprout and take root after spraying, and if there is a large amount of rainfall during the period until planting to a certain extent, the soil will run off and the planting will not be greened. Therefore, there was a drawback that the construction itself became large-scale, such as covering with a net for the purpose of preventing the runoff, and the cost was increased.

[0005] In addition, crushed chips of grasses and trees generated by logging at the site are mixed for the purpose of disposal at the site and long-term replenishment of fertilizer to vegetation plants. In the sense of prevention, since the soil is generally densely formed, moisture and oxygen are not sufficiently supplied to the bacteria for turning the crushed chips into putrefaction compost, so that the composting does not progress as a result, There were many cases where this was a problem.

According to the first aspect of the present invention, since the crushed pieces of bark of cedar and hinoki mixed with each other have a feather-like fibrous structure, they are entangled with each other and exhibit a certain bonding force. It works to prevent the runoff of soil. As a result, the right vegetation base is maintained on the slope, which contributes to long-term greening.

[0010] The crushed pieces are microscopically divided into a large number of small rooms containing air and moisture therein.
Due to its cell structure, a certain gas and liquid phase is formed in the sprayed soil, which helps the growth of bacteria and promotes the composting of crushed chips of grasses and trees generated by cutting down contaminated sites. Work. Therefore, long-term supply of fertilizer to the slope will contribute to long-term greening.

[0011] In addition, the bark of cedar and cypress has pest repellent properties, so that the growth of pests such as brown rice in the soil is suppressed, so that the roots of vegetation are not eaten and consequently long-term greening is achieved. Contribute to maintenance.

[0012] In claim 2 of the present invention, in addition to claim 1, since the mixed granular charcoal is porous, it takes in moisture and fertilizer into the inside thereof, and further improves water retention and fertilization. As a result, it contributes to long-term greening maintenance.

[0013] Furthermore, granular coal has a heat retaining property due to the carbon material, and contributes to long-term greening maintenance by mitigating a nighttime temperature drop in winter and protecting roots.

[0015] As shown in Fig. 1, the slope spraying is generally performed on a sloped slope and a part of a top flat portion.
If necessary, it may be applied to the lower flat part. The thickness of the sprayed layer is generally about 3 to 10 cm, but depending on the case, it may be as thick as about 25 cm. In addition, the slope angle of the slope may vary from a gentle slope of about 20 degrees to a steep slope of about 75 degrees, and in some cases, is applied to a vertically steep cliff.

FIG. 2 shows an example of a conventional construction method. In this case, seeds 1b of vegetation such as flowers and trees are mixed in the soil 1a in an appropriate amount. An appropriate amount of fertilizer 1c such as phosphoric acid / potassium was mixed in, and an appropriate amount of crushed chips 1d of grasses and trees generated by cutting on site was also mixed in and sprayed with a compressor.

On the other hand, FIG. 3 shows an embodiment according to the first aspect of the present invention. In FIG. 2, crushed pieces of bark of cedar and hinoki are additionally mixed in with FIG. 2 and sprayed by a compressor. The crushed pieces of the bark of this cedar or cypress are usually needle-shaped fibers or crushed pieces in the state of feathers, and the thickness of the fibers is about 0.1 to 1 mm in diameter.
The length is about 5 to 30 mm. The mixing amount is usually in the range of 10 to 40% by volume with respect to the soil, and if it is less than this, it is not possible to sufficiently secure both the gas phase and the liquid phase. Is not enough.

The granular coal is usually substantially spherical, and its size is about 0.1 to 2 mm in diameter. Usually, the mixing amount of the granular coal is desirably in the range of 3 to 10% by volume with respect to the soil. If the amount is less than this, the water retention / fertilization and heat retaining effects of the granular coal cannot be expected much. The supply will be insufficient.
